Abstract

A technique that is usable with a well includes communicating a ballistic wave from a first point in a well to a second point in the well without propagating the ballistic wave along a detonating cord. The first and second points are separated by at least one foot. The technique includes responding to the ballistic wave near the second point to activate a downhole tool.

Claims

exact text as granted — not AI-modified
1 . A method usable with a well, comprising:
 communicating a ballistic wave from a first point in the well to a second point in the well without propagating the ballistic wave along a detonating cord, the first and second points being separated by at least one foot; and   responding to the ballistic wave near the second point to actuate a downhole tool.   
   
   
       2 . The method of  claim 1 , wherein the downhole tool comprises a perforating gun. 
   
   
       3 . The method of  claim 1 , wherein the communicating comprises:
 communicating through a communication barrier.   
   
   
       4 . The method of  claim 3 , wherein the communication barrier comprises a casing joint. 
   
   
       5 . The method of  claim 1 , wherein the downhole tool comprises a casing conveyed perforating gun. 
   
   
       6 . The method of  claim 1 , further comprising:
 generating the ballistic wave in response to the propagation of a detonation wave along a detonating cord.   
   
   
       7 . A system usable with a well, comprising:
 a ballistic generator located at a first point in the well to generate a ballistic wave; and   a tool being located at a second point in the well to respond to the ballistic wave,   wherein the ballistic wave does not propagate along a detonating cord between the first and second points, and the first and second points are separated by at least one foot.   
   
   
       8 . The system of  claim 7 , wherein the tool comprises a perforating gun. 
   
   
       9 . The system of  claim 7 , wherein the communicating comprises:
 communicating through a communication barrier.   
   
   
       10 . The system of  claim 9 , wherein the communication barrier comprises a casing joint. 
   
   
       11 . The system of  claim 7 , wherein the tool comprises a casing conveyed perforating gun. 
   
   
       12 . The system of  claim 7 , further comprising:
 generating the ballistic wave in response to the propagation of a detonation wave along a detonating cord.
